Video: The Journey to Smart Manufacturing

 

A new way of looking at your business paradigm

In this video, Hitachi Consulting shares insights on the next generation of manufacturing and the industrial internet of things.

"Massive amounts of big data... describes not only what you're doing in the industrial value chain, but what you did in the past and what you will do in the future," says Greg Kinsey, VP of Industrial Solutions and Innovations. Rajesh Devnani, VP of Global Solutions Management adds, "the managers [working with IIoT] are clearly seeing in terms of...operations and that's really enabled by IOT."
